Cop arrested after murder of 3 civilians in KZN
Updated | By Nothando Mkhize
The Independent Police Investigative Directorate (IPID) is investigating the circumstances surrounding a triple killing in the KZN Midlands.

The police watchdog says three people were murdered -- allegedly -- as a result of police action in Phuphuma on Saturday.
IPID spokesperson Ndileka Cola says a police officer has been taken into custody for alleged involvement.

"The IPID investigators responded swiftly to the crime scene to conduct an investigation.
"The South African Police Services arrested the police officer who is alleged to have caused the death of three deceased persons.
"IPID is gathering more valuable information relating to this incident through its investigation process." says Cola.
